Standards & Benchmarks Ranbaxy Fine Chem gets ISO certification Our Bureau
New Delhi , Dec. 9 RANBAXY Laboratories Ltd today said that its allied business division, Ranbaxy Fine Chemicals Ltd (RFCL), has been awarded ISO14001:1996 Certification from TUV Suddeutschland India. This puts RFCL amongst the few global companies in the chemical industry to get this certification. The recognition is reflective of the company's commitment to embrace stricter environment and quality management standards enabling it to strengthen its position as a reliable manufacturer and marketer of fine chemicals, said an official statement. RFCL commands 11 per cent market share in India and has a significant presence in the international market. RFCL is engaged in the production of reagents and fine chemicals used in manufacturing processes for specialised industries and laboratory chemicals used in research and development. It markets over 1,000 products through a strong marketing and distribution network within India and overseas. It also has exclusive marketing rights, in India, for over 17,500 rare chemicals and 500 presentations belonging to Acros Organics and other leading companies.
